NEET Exam Centres in MP 2026 (City List & Codes)
The NEET MP Exam Centre List 2026 contains the main cities as well as district headquarters where the examination can be held. Applicants can select any of these places to fill out the application form.
Below is the complete list of NEET exam centres in Madhya Pradesh 2026 along with city codes and districts:
| City Code | Exam City | District |
| 3001 | Bhopal | Bhopal |
| 3002 | Gwalior | Gwalior |
| 3003 | Indore | Indore |
| 3004 | Jabalpur | Jabalpur |
| 3005 | Ujjain | Ujjain |
| 3006 | Rewa | Rewa |
| 3007 | Ashok Nagar | Ashok Nagar |
| 3008 | Balaghat | Balaghat |
| 3009 | Barwani | Barwani |
| 3010 | Betul | Betul |
| 3011 | Bhind | Bhind |
| 3012 | Chhatarpur | Chhatarpur |
| 3013 | Chhindwara | Chhindwara |
| 3014 | Damoh | Damoh |
| 3015 | Datia | Datia |
| 3016 | Deoghar | Deoghar |
| 3017 | Dewas | Dewas |
| 3018 | Dhar | Dhar |
| 3019 | Guna | Guna |
| 3020 | Hoshangabad | Hoshangabad |
| 3021 | Khandwa | Khandwa |
| 3022 | Khargone | Khargone |
| 3023 | Mandsaur | Mandsaur |
| 3024 | Morena | Morena |
| 3025 | Neemuch | Neemuch |
| 3026 | Rajgarh | Rajgarh |
| 3027 | Ratlam | Ratlam |
| 3028 | Sagar | Sagar |
| 3029 | Satna | Satna |
| 3030 | Singrauli | Singrauli |
| 3031 | Vidisha | Vidisha |

How to Check NEET Exam Centre (Admit Card)
Candidates can check their NEET exam centre in MP only when the admit cards are issued, after application submission.
Here is the method how the exam centre can be checked:
- Visit the official NEET website.
- Log in with the registration number and password.
- Click on the Download Admit Card button.
- Get details about the exam city, venue, and time.
- Print the admit card for the exam day.
It is necessary to bring the admit card at the time of the exam because it contains the details of the candidate’s NEET exam centre in MP.

Is it possible to change the NEET exam centre?
Sometimes, students want to change the location of their exam centre.
The National Testing Agency issues a correction window for candidates to make changes to their application.
Here is how you can change the exam centre:
- Go to the official NEET website.
- Log into account with your username and password.
- Access the Application Correction Window.
- Change the exam city preferences.
- Confirm the changes and download the acknowledgement slip.
